About Aluminum Electrolytic Capacitors


Aluminum electrolytic capacitors use an electrolyte-soaked paper as the dielectric and are known for their high capacitance values. These capacitors are commonly used in power supply applications, audio systems, and electronic equipment requiring bulk energy storage. Aluminum electrolytic capacitors provide high capacitance in a relatively small package.
